
Livingston, Steelheads Agree to Terms
September 23, 2014 - ECHL (ECHL)
Idaho Steelheads News Release
Boise, ID (9/23/14) - Head Coach and Director of Hockey Operations Brad Ralph announced Tuesday that the ECHL's Idaho Steelheads have agreed to terms with forward James Livingston.
The 24-year-old Livingston has appeared in 202 pro hockey games, all of them in the American Hockey League for the Worcester Sharks and Manchester Monarchs. Between the Sharks and Monarchs last season, Livingston totaled a career-best eight goals and 23 points in 67 games. He spent the end of last season in Manchester as a teammate of Steve Quailer, who agreed to terms with Idaho last week. Livingston was also a third-round draft pick of the NHL's St. Louis Blues in 2008.
Ralph on Livingston: "James is a solid, two-way player who plays the game the right way. He'll add offense and grit to our lineup along with leadership qualities."
